Confirmed case of Swine Flu in Tuscola County
CARO, Mich., August 3, 2023 – The Tuscola County Health Department (TCHD) has received notification that a Tuscola
County resident with flu-like symptoms who attended the Tuscola County Fair which took place July 23-29 at the
fairgrounds in Caro has tested positive for Influenza A H1N1v, commonly known as swine flu. Tuscola County Swine Flu PRESS RELEASE
